The Indian Ministry of External Affairs (MEA) has said that its border security froce Sashastra Seema Bal (SSB) has initiated an enquiry on the death of a Nepal man,

allegedly in a firing by SSB, at Nepal-India border in Kanchanpur district on Thursday.

A 32-year-old man from Ananda Bazaar of Punarbas Municipality-8 in Kanchanpur district died when India’s SSB allegedly opened fire on locals at border on Thursday. The victim has been identified as Gobinda Gautam of Punarbas Municipality-8.
